More about Lower Queen Anne, Seattle

Lower Queen Anne is a neighborhood in Seattle, Washington, at the base of Queen Anne Hill. While its boundaries are not precise, the toponym usually refers to the shopping, office, and residential districts to the north and west of Seattle Center. The neighborhood is connected to Upper Queen Anne—the shopping district at the top of the hill—by an extremely steep section of Queen Anne Avenue N. known as the Counterbalance, in memory of the cable cars that once ran up and down it.While "Lower Queen Anne" and "Uptown" are rarely used to refer to the grounds of Seattle Center itself, many of Seattle Center's leading attractions abut the neighborhood; these include KeyArena, the Exhibition Hall, McCaw Hall, the Cornish Playhouse, and the Bagley Wright Theater, as well as the Mercer Arena.Lower Queen Anne also has a three-screen movie theater, the Uptown, and On the Boards, a center for avant-garde theater and music.
